Output ddc8447a64b61e3ddec33c6d36cbe7f039de961c27cbd895019ae156875415c1:2

value
93640222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a7ed1c18a87643b29e37ad1101853cd78ae5d1 OP_EQUAL
address
MAy7hUgwzeiYwFpijHin1R1oRDZBr2nnHF
transaction
ddc8447a64b61e3ddec33c6d36cbe7f039de961c27cbd895019ae156875415c1
spent
true